电商平台比价 API 接口的详细说明,涵盖定义、核心功能、主流平台推荐、技术实现及注意事项:
一、电商比价 API 概述
电商比价 API 是连接多平台(如淘宝、京东1688等)的商品价格数据接口,支持开发者 / 企业实时获取商品价格、促销信息、历史价格等,用于构建比价工具、价格监控系统或智能调价策略。
核心作用:
- 实时数据获取:支持分钟级更新,获取全网主流平台的商品面价、。
- 自动化比价:通过关键词、商品 ID 等参数,批量对比多平台价格,生成价格趋势报告。
- 场景扩展:适用于品牌定价、采购比价、竞品监控、促销策略制定等。
二、主流比价 API 平台推荐
三、比价 API 使用步骤(以通用流程为例)
- 注册与申请 API Key
- 平台注册用户,创建应用,获取
API Key
和Secret Key
。 - 示例:淘宝开放平台需完成企业 / 个人认证,勾选 “商品详情 API” 权限。
请求参数:q=女装&sort=&mall_id=&category_id=&mode=
参数说明:mode:选择模式(默认为比价模式,直接使用,需要获取mall_id,mcategory_id则传cat)
q:关键词
sort:排序(传new为最新排序,默认是综合排序)
mall_id:平台ID(默认是各个平台的数据,加了则是限定返回此平台的商品)
category_id:分类ID(默认为关键词的分类,加了则分类更精确)
- 数据解析与应用
- 解析返回数据(价格、库存、优惠信息等),存入数据库或生成可视化报表。
- 示例:监控到竞品降价时,触发自动调价或钉钉报警。
四、技术请求示例(Python 调用淘宝比价 API)
# coding:utf-8
"""
Compatible for python2.x and python3.x
requirement: pip install requests
"""
from __future__ import print_function
import requests
# 请求示例 url 默认请求参数已经做URL编码
url = "https://api-gw.onebound.cn/t1j/item_search_bijia/?key=t6616866138&secret=6138148e&q=女装&sort=&mall_id=&category_id=&mode="
headers = {
"Accept-Encoding": "gzip",
"Connection": "close"
}
if __name__ == "__main__":
r = requests.get(url, headers=headers)
json_obj = r.json()
print(json_obj)
五、注意事项
- 合规性:
- 使用官方 API(如1688,淘宝、京东)避免爬虫风险,遵守平台数据使用协议。
- 标注数据来源(如 “数据来自 XX 开放平台”)。
- 加密传输(HTTPS),定期更换 API 密钥。
- 避免敏感信息泄露(如
Secret Key
不可硬编码)。
六、应用场景
- 企业应用:
- 品牌方:监控竞品价格,制定定价策略。
- 电商采购:对比供应商报价与平台价格,优化采购成本。
- 零售商:实时调整价格,保持竞争力(如对手降价时自动跟价)。
总结
电商比价 API 是实现高效价格监控与决策的核心工具,选择可靠平台重点关注合规性、实时性与数据质量,结合业务场景(如大促监控、品牌控价)发挥 API 价值,避免人工比价的低效与误差,如何获得此API点击此注册
通过合理使用比价 API,企业可显著提升价格竞争力,消费者可享受更便捷的购物体验。